| 正面描述 | Highly stylized and abstracted Celtic design featuring a large triskelion-like swirl motif composed of bold, curvilinear arcs radiating from a central pellet or ring, rendered in high relief. The design is entirely non-figural, displaying the characteristic La Tène artistic vocabulary of dynamic, interconnected spiral forms. The irregular flan shows the characteristic surface texture of a hammered electrum blank. No legend or inscription is present. The overall composition fills the entire field with rhythmic, flowing lines typical of Belgic Celtic coinage derived from the abstraction of earlier Macedonian stater prototypes. |

| 背面描述 | Stylized Celtic horse prancing left, rendered in a highly schematic manner characteristic of Belgic La Tène coinage. The horse's body is reduced to bold, rounded forms with disjointed legs and an exaggerated arched neck, reflecting the progressive abstraction of the Philip II stater prototype. A crescent-shaped device appears beneath the horse, while a cluster of pellets and a star-like symbol occupy the upper right field. Additional abstract ornamental elements fill the surrounding field. No legend or inscription is present. |
